Hickory Corner Community Center Feb. 10
The Hickory Corner Community Center is having its annual Valentines Party on Saturday, Feb. 10, beginning at noon with a potluck finger food meal. Following the meal, there will be a drawing for King and Queen then games of Bingo. Soft drinks will be provided by the Center. Everyone is invited to come join us for a period of fellowship and fun. Just bring your favorite sandwiches or finger foods, a dessert, and an inexpensive Bingo prize.

Finger Volunteer Fire Dept. Fish Fry Feb. 10
Finger Volunteer Fire Department will hold a fish fry and barbeque chicken dinner from 2-5:50 p.m. Saturday, Feb. 10. There will be all you can eat fish or chicken with all the trimmings and homemade desserts. Dine in or carry out will be available. Cost is $14 for adults and $6 for children. All to go plates are $14. All proceeds will go towards the operating expenses of the Finger Fire Dept.

Sweetlips Community Center Stew/Bake Sale Feb. 10
The Sweetlips Community Center Stew/Bake Sale will be Feb. 10 at the Sweetlips Community Center. Snow date is Feb. 17. Stew will be ready at 10:30 a.m. Bring your own container for the stew. All proceeds going to the upkeep and maintenance of the fire department and community center. The stew goes quickly and is $25 per gallon. Seventh Annual Black History Program Feb. 17, 2024
The Seventh Annual Black History Program will be from 2-4 p.m. Feb 17, 2024 at 247 E Main St. in Henderson. We are inviting volunteers to share their talent with our community. Singers, artists, dancers and poets are welcomed. Chester County students are invited to create foldable poster boards about our theme, “African Americans and The Arts.” The poster boards will be displayed at different locations in Henderson for the month of February. Deadline for submitting a poster is Jan 26, 2024. This will be a free event that the entire family can enjoy.
